#3257db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3257db is composed of 19.6% red, 34.1%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.2% cyan, 60.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 226.9 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 52.7%. #3257db color hex could be obtained by blending #64aeff with #0000b7.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#3257db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3257db has RGB values of R:50, G:87,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 3299291.

Hex triplet 3257db #3257db
RGB Decimal 50, 87, 219 rgb(50,87,219)
RGB Percent 19.6, 34.1, 85.9 rgb(19.6%,34.1%,85.9%)
CMYK 77, 60, 0, 14
HSL 226.9°, 70.1, 52.7 hsl(226.9,70.1%,52.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 226.9°, 77.2, 85.9
Web Safe 3366cc #3366cc
CIE-LAB 42.166, 33.771, -71.106
XYZ 17.507, 12.608, 68.525
xyY 0.177, 0.128, 12.608
CIE-LCH 42.166, 78.718, 295.404
CIE-LUV 42.166, -15.321, -105.826
Hunter-Lab 35.507, 25.872, -89.567
Binary 00110010, 01010111, 11011011

Shades and Tints of #3257db

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02040c is the darkest color, while #fafbfe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#3257db is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#5b5b5b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#535a75 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#0068cc Protanopia 1% of men
  • #006eb2 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#00767c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#1262d1 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#1265c0 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#126a9f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
